Spanish[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Latin grandiloquus, from grandis (great, full) + loquor (speak).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/ɡɾandiloˈkwente/ [ɡɾãn̪.d̪i.loˈkwẽn̪.t̪e]
  • Rhymes: -ente
  • Syllabification: gran‧di‧lo‧cuen‧te

Adjective[edit]

grandilocuente m or f (masculine and feminine plural grandilocuentes)

  1. grandiloquent
    Synonym: grandílocuo
